Different Types of BMW Keys
Before talking about the expenses related to BMW Replacement Key Cost key replacement, it's necessary to comprehend the various kinds of keys readily available for BMW cars. The type of key can significantly affect the general cost.
Standard Key:

- Typically utilized for older BMW models, standard keys are basic, metal keys without any sophisticated innovation.
- Approximated Cost: ₤ 20 - ₤ 50.
Transponder Key:
- Introduced in more recent models, transponder keys come equipped with a microchip that interacts with the automobile's immobilizer system to boost security.
- Estimated Cost: ₤ 100 - ₤ 250.
Smart Key (Key Fob):
- The most current development in BMW technology, clever keys or key fobs enable for keyless entry and ignition. These keys contain innovative innovation, including remote functions.
- Estimated Cost: ₤ 300 - ₤ 600.
Key Card:
- Some of the most recent BMW designs also enable keyless entry utilizing a key card.
- Approximated Cost: ₤ 400 - ₤ 700.
| Key Type | Cost Range |
|---|---|
| Standard Key | ₤ 20 - ₤ 50 |
| Transponder Key | ₤ 100 - ₤ 250 |
| Smart Key (Fob) | ₤ 300 - ₤ 600 |
| Key Card | ₤ 400 - ₤ 700 |
Factors Influencing the Replacement Cost
Numerous factors can influence the overall cost when needing a Replacement BMW Key key for a BMW car. These factors include:
Type of Key: As highlighted, the type of key significantly dictates the cost.
Model Year: Newer models often include sophisticated technology, resulting in higher replacement costs.
Dealership vs. Locksmith: Getting a replacement key from an authorized BMW dealership is typically more pricey than going with a regional locksmith, though the latter may not have access to all BMW key types.
Setting Fees: All BMW keys, particularly transponder and clever keys, require programming to deal with the specific vehicle, which can sustain extra expenses.
Area: Prices might vary based on geographic area and availability of services, with metropolitan areas typically charging more.

Extra Features: If the key includes extra functions like remote start or keyless entry, costs will be greater.
The Replacement Process
Replacing a BMW key includes several steps. Understanding this procedure can help simplify the experience and potentially conserve expenses.
Recognizing Key Type: Determine what kind of key is needed for your BMW model.
Getting in touch with a Dealer or Locksmith: Reach out to a BMW car dealership or a certified locksmith that is familiar with BMW key replacements.
Offering Vehicle Information: Be prepared to provide your vehicle identification number (VIN) and evidence of ownership for security checks.
Setting the Key: Following the key cutting, the key will go through programming. This step is essential for guaranteeing that the New BMW Key Fob key can interact with the car.
Testing the Key: Once the new key is programmed, ensure that all performances are working correctly.

FAQ: BMW Replacement Key Cost
1. How much does it cost to replace a lost BMW key?
The cost implies the key type. Standard keys range from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50, while clever keys can cost in between ₤ 300 to ₤ 600.
2. Can I get a BMW key made at a regular locksmith?
While some locksmith professionals may handle BMW keys, authorized dealers typically supply a more smooth experience with access to the suitable shows tools.
3. Will my insurance coverage cover the cost of a replacement key?
Insurance plan vary extensively. It's recommended to call your insurance coverage supplier to see if key replacement is included in your protection.
4. The length of time does it require to get a new BMW key?
Replacement time can differ based upon the key type and service provider, but it normally ranges from a couple of hours to a couple of days, especially if programming is required.
5. Is it possible to avoid losing my BMW key?
Making use of smart key tracking devices or key locators can help lessen the threat of misplacing your keys.
